Give Your Treatments And Products A Test Run Long Before The Wedding

Many brides, in the name of perfect skin, are tempted to try out a slew of new treatments and products before the big day. But changing your skincare routine and introducing new ingredients into your regimen days before your wedding can be a recipe for disaster.

The last thing you want is to find yourself dealing with a skin reaction before your big day. Even if your skin isn’t super sensitive, a harsh chemical peel or a new ingredient your skin isn’t used to can cause redness, irritation, peeling - not exactly the look you’re going for.

So, if you want to avoid wearing your veil all day to shield wedding guests from your skin reaction, make sure you give any treatments or products you’re thinking about using a test run well before the wedding - a few months out is a good rule of thumb. That way, if your skin reacts negatively, you have plenty of time to repair it before it’s time to walk down the aisle.

Take A Deep Breath and Destress

A wedding is a joyful event, but if you’re the bride, it can also be BEYOND stressful. Dealing with family, coordinating with all the vendors, fighting with your fiance over the reception playlist (if they play “Cotton Eyed Joe”, you swear, you’re calling off the wedding!)... all the stress can start to add up.

And when you’re stressed on the inside, it’s going to show up on the outside: on your face.

Too much stress is no good for your complexion. When your body is under stress, it releases a hormone called cortisol, which wreaks havoc on the skin and can cause everything from breakouts, dryness, excess oil, wrinkles… you name it, stress will probably cause it.

That’s why it’s SO important to take a deep breath, relax, and take care of yourself in the middle of all the wedding chaos. The less stress you feel, the less cortisol your body will produce - and the less complexion issues you’ll face on the big day.

Make time for self care ritual in the weeks leading up to the wedding. Schedule a massage. Take a bath and indulge in some aromatherapy (a few drops of lavender essential oil in your bathwater and the Lace Your Face Calming Chamomile are a match made in heaven!). When you feel stress starting to overwhelm you, close your eyes and breathe deeply until the moment passes.

Remember, less stress = better skin.


Make Hyaluronic Acid Your New BFF

Now, your current BFF is probably busy playing Maid of Honor, so before your wedding, it’s time to make a new BFF - hyaluronic acid.

Hyaluronic acid is a humectant, which means it binds moisture to the skin. We’re born with a TON of hyaluronic acid in our skin and it’s what gives babies that plump, dewy look we’re all dying for in adulthood. But as we get older, our bodies produce less and less hyaluronic acid, making our skin look dull and dry and leading to all sorts of fun things like deep lines and wrinkles.

But thankfully, that plump, dewy, hydrated look is just a product or two away. Adding hyaluronic acid topically binds moisture to the skin and can turn back the clock in terms of aging.
